Field Rifle
|
|
Field Rifle is shot over distances from 100m to 300m, in 100m increments.
Field Rifle shooters may use any calibre rifle up to a maximum 8mm and any suitable projectile.
Shooting positions vary from prone (lying down), sitting or kneeling and standing.
All forms of front rests including bipods and scopes are permitted.
Field Rifle is a great way to get both new shooters and juniors involved in the sport.
